Amazon เพิ่มความสามารถให้ FreeRTOS อัปเดตผ่านอากาศได้

Amazon FreeRTOS หรือ OS สำหรับไมโครคอนโทรลเลอร์บนอุปกรณ์ เช่น เซนเซอร์ อุปกรณ์ติดตามการออกกำลังกาย สมาร์ทมิเตอร์ และอื่นๆ ปัญหาคืออุปกรณ์บางตัวไม่สามารถรับการอัปเดตตัว Firmware ขณะใช้งานอยู่ภาคสนามได้ต้องถอดออกมาทำให้เกิดความไม่สะดวกหลายประการ ทาง Amazon ครั้งนี้จึงได้มีการเพิ่มความสามารถให้ FreeRTOS สามารถอัปเดตผ่านอากาศได้แล้วพร้อมกับข้อดีอื่นด้วยเช่นกัน

Credit: AWS

คุณสมบัติสำคัญอื่นๆ จากการอัปเดตผ่านอากาศ (Over-the-air) มีดังนี้

  • ความมั่นคงปลอดภัย ตัวอัปเดตสามารถทำการ Code Signing ได้เพื่อตรวจสอบการแก้ไขเปลี่ยนแปลงข้อมูลและมีการเชื่อมต่อไปยังอุปกรณ์ผ่าน TLS ด้วย
  • ทนทานต่อการผิดพลาด ระบบจะสามารถจัดการกับการอัปเดตที่ได้รับมาเพียงบางส่วนไม่ให้เกิดผลกระทบหลังจากเกิดการอัปเดตล้มเหลวเพื่อให้อุปกรณ์ยังทำงานได้สเถียรต่อไป
  • รองรับขยายจำนวนได้ สามารถทำการแบ่งกลุ่มการอัปเดตอุปกรณ์ได้ตามความต้องการด้วย AWS IoT Device Management
  • ประหยัดทรัพยากร ตัวไมโครคอนโทรลเลอร์มีหน่วยความจำไม่มากนัก (128 Kb หรือมากกว่านั้น) เช่นกันกับพลังประมวลผล ดังนั้น Amazon FreeRTOS จึงใช้การเชื่อมต่อ TLS ครั้งเดียวและอื่นๆ ของ AWS IoT Core ผ่านทางโปรโตคอล MQTT

อย่างไรก็ตามที่ตัวอุปกรณ์เองก็ต้องมีไลบรารี่อัปเดต OTA ด้วยโดยภายในนั้นจะมี Agent ที่คอยรอรับการอัปเดตและคุมกระบวนการอัปเดต ผู้สนใจสามารถศึกษาเพิ่มเติมได้ที่ OTA Turorial

ที่มา : https://aws.amazon.com/blogs/aws/new-over-the-air-ota-updates-for-amazon-freertos/

About nattakon

จบการศึกษา ปริญญาตรีและโท สาขาวิศวกรรมคอมพิวเตอร์ KMITL เคยทำงานด้าน Engineer/Presale ดูแลผลิตภัณฑ์ด้าน Network Security และ Public Cloud ในประเทศ ปัจจุบันเป็นนักเขียน Full-time ที่ TechTalkThai

Check Also

Salesforce เข้าซื้อกิจการ Fin มูลค่าราว 3,600 ล้านดอลลาร์ เสริมแกร่ง AI Agent งานบริการลูกค้า

Salesforce ประกาศลงนามข้อตกลงขั้นสุดท้ายเข้าซื้อกิจการ Fin ผู้ให้บริการแพลตฟอร์ม customer agent ในมูลค่าราว 3,600 ล้านดอลลาร์สหรัฐ เพื่อนำเทคโนโลยี AI Agent สำหรับงานบริการลูกค้ามาเสริมความสามารถให้กับ Agentforce

Cisco ออกแพตช์แก้ช่องโหว่ Zero-day บน Catalyst SD-WAN Manager ที่ถูกใช้โจมตียกระดับสิทธิ์เป็น root

Cisco ปล่อยอัปเดตด้านความปลอดภัยแก้ช่องโหว่บน Catalyst SD-WAN Manager (เดิมคือ SD-WAN vManage) หลังพบว่าถูกใช้โจมตีจริงในลักษณะ Zero-day เพื่อยกระดับสิทธิ์เป็น root บนระบบที่ได้รับผลกระทบ